12. Pyramid of Djoser (2700 BC), Egypt

The Pyramid of Djoser is just one part of this majestic piece of history.

Built by man from stone and still a mystery, these majestic giant structures date back to 2700 BC.

There are also tombs in Egypt, such as the Meidum Pyramid, Bent Pyramid, and the Red Pyramid, each with different architectural features.

The Great Pyramids of Giza, which are also located here, have recently become the center of attention with the large cavity discovered inside them. It is thought that this cavity, the size of a passenger plane, will help to solve the secret of the construction of the pyramids.
